Can you convert IU's into ml's?

SAF

New member
Lets say you have 18iu, can you convert this into ml? Just wondering because the concept of IU has always confused me. :)

SAF
 
IU'S are means of measuring concentration that is why you you will see for example 16iu's per ml etc.

You will need to see what context the 18iu's are in. By that I mean if you have a vial with GH in that is 36iu's per ml then it stans to reason that 18iu's would mean that you have .5ml of the soultion.

However there is no direct correlation or conversion between IU's and ml's
 
Purple is right. It sounds like your doing serostim, so the ML = the amount of sterile water you use to mix it. If you are trying to use a specific # of IU's just devide it. IE 1/2 cc = 9IU's 1/4 = 4 1/2 IU's.
 
1mg of substance equals 3IU. So serostim 6mg is 18IU. Suppose I want to do 3IU for 6 days. So now add 6 ml of sterile water to the 18IU vial. Your concentration is now 18IU per 6ml or 3IU per ml. Now, you inject 1ml (which contains 3IU). This is why you guys had to learn algebra.
 
"1mg of substance equals 3IU. "

An IU has NO milligram, microgram, gram, etc. equality. An IU is an International Unit, which is a measurement of ACTIVITY, not true weight/mass. An IU is determined by an international commitee of scientists who wish to standardize biological compounds, such as vitamins (A, E, D, etc.), hormones (insulin, GH, etc.).

So in the case of GH, 1mg DOES equal 3IU's, but this is not the case for any other compound, such as beta-carotene, which is something like 6.25mg equals 1,000 IU's.

Also, IU's cannot be equated to a volume, since this is arbitrary. The IU's/ml is determined by the person who makes the solution.
